The Comminuted Fracture Explained Types Treatments A comminuted fracture is a severe type of bone injury characterized by the breaking of a bone into three or more fragments. Unlike simple fractures, where the bone cracks or breaks into two pieces, comminuted fractures involve multiple fragments that can be challenging to treat and require specialized medical attention. These injuries often occur from high-impact trauma such as car accidents, falls from significant heights, or crushing injuries, which exert enough force to shatter the bone.
The complexity of comminuted fractures makes understanding their types and treatment options essential for effective recovery. Generally, these fractures can be classified based on the location and pattern of the break. For instance, they can be classified as intra-articular if they extend into the joint space, increasing the risk of joint instability and arthritis. They may also be categorized by the pattern of fragmentation, such as transverse, oblique, or comminuted, with the latter indicating multiple fragments.
The treatment of comminuted fractures depends on several factors, including the location of the fracture, the extent of the fragmentation, the patient’s age, overall health, and activity level. The primary goal is to restore the alignment and stability of the bone to facilitate healing and regain function. Often, initial management involves immobilization with casts or splints to prevent further injury. However, due to the fragmented nature, surgical intervention is frequently necessary.
Surgical options include open reduction and internal fixation (ORIF), where metal plates, screws, or rods are used to hold the bone fragments together. In some cases, especially when fragments are too small or comminution is extensive, external fixation devices may be employed. These devices stabilize the bone from outside the body and are adjustable to facilitate realignment during healing. Bone grafts or substitutes are sometimes used to fill voids created by the fragmentation, promoting new bone growth.
Rehabilitation plays a vital role after surgical treatment. Once the initial healing phase is complete, physical therapy helps restore movement, strength, and function. The recovery period can be lengthy, potentially taking several months, depending on the severity of the fracture and the patient’s overall health. Complications such as infection, delayed healing, non-union (failure of the bone to heal), or malunion (healing in a wrong position) are risks associated with comminuted fractures, underscoring the importance of proper management and follow-up.
